Description The Keyless Ride System (KLR) is an electronic unit for vehicles, composed by:
- the main unit (1), which provides the following functions:
user recognizer, by means of an active key (2) or a passive key (3);
Fuel Tank Cap opening (4);
the enable and disable of the ignition of the bike;
the Lock and Unlock of the steering, by moving a bolt (7);
the arming and disarming of the anti-theft alarm system;
- the active key (2);
- the passive key, an RFID transponder (3). The customer should provide the following connections:
- LF antenna;
- external push button called Lock/Unlock button (6);
- CAN bus;
- fuel tank cap. The KLR-System combines the transponder functionality (LF, Low Frequency 134.5 kHz) and the radio controller transmission (HF, High Frequency 433.92 MHz) to recognize the right user of the vehicle. The system is integrated on CAN bus to communicate with the other electronic units on the vehicle. May 30th 2019 DO01-#100624-v1-BMW_KLR_K35_USERMANUAL.doc 3 ZADI S.p.A. 1.1 Key ON 1.1.1 Normal Mode The user recognizing with the active key (2) is performed as described below:
press the Lock/Unlock button (6) on the handlebar of the vehicle for less than 1 second
(customizable parameter);
the main unit (1) performs the radio frequency authentication of the key (2 or 3) by sending a request on LF band though the LF antenna (5);
if the active key (2) is within the LF detection range (1.5 m) and the battery is charged, then it replies to the main unit (1) by transmitting its ID via an HF signal;
the main unit (1) receives the information through an internal HF antenna;
if the main unit (1) recognizes the active key (2):
1. starts the transmission of a periodical message on CAN bus;
2. if the steering is:
a. locked: unlocks it by retracting the bolt (7);
i. press the Lock/Unlock button (6) on the handlebar of the ii. vehicle for less than 1 second (customizable parameter);
if the main unit (1) recognizes the active key (2), then it sets KL15 ON;
b. unlocked: sets KL15 ON. Note: when the battery is discharged, the active key (2) acts like a passive key (3), as reports below. 1.1.2 Emergency Mode The user recognizing with the passive key (3), or with a discharged active key (2), is performed as described below:
press the Lock/Unlock button (6) on the handlebar of the vehicle for less than 1 second
(customizable parameter);
the main unit (1) performs the radio frequency authentication of the key (2 or 3) by sending a request on LF band though the LF antenna (5);
if the passive key (3) is within a range of distance up to 5 cm near the LF antenna (5), then it replies to the main unit (1) by transmitting its ID via a backscattered LF signal;
the main unit (1) receives the information through the LF antenna (5);
if the main unit (1) recognizes the passive key (3):
3. starts the transmission of a periodical message on CAN bus;
4. if the steering is:
a. locked: unlocks it by retracting the bolt (7);
i. press the Lock/Unlock button (6) on the handlebar of the ii. vehicle for less than 1 second (customizable parameter);
if the main unit (1) recognizes the passive key (3), then it sets KL15 ON;
b. unlocked: sets KL15 ON. 1.2 Key OFF When vehicle speed is equal to zero, by pressing the button (6) on the handlebar for less than 1 second (customizable parameter) the system goes in deactivation state for 2 minutes
(customizable parameter); this is the time necessary to be able to open the fuel tank cap (4), after that Key OFF state occurs (KL15 OFF). Neither active key (2) nor passive key (3) are required. May 30th 2019 DO01-#100624-v1-BMW_KLR_K35_USERMANUAL.doc 4 ZADI S.p.A. 1.3 Steering lock To engage the steering lock:
stop the vehicle (perform a Key OFF);
keep the active key (2) or the passive key (3) within the recognizing area;
press the Lock/Unlock button (6) and hold it depressed for more than 3 seconds
(customizable parameter) with steering turned completely to the left or to the right:
steering lock will be engaged after this time (the bolt of the system (7) goes out). 1.4 Steering unlock To unlock the steering, perform the Key ON procedure. 1.5 Fuel Tank Cap opening Stop the vehicle and press the Lock/Unlock button (6). The fuel tank cap (4) can be opened in two ways:
Variant 1: Within the deactivation time Pull the lid of the fuel tank cap (4) slowly upwards;
Fuel tank cap (4) unlocked;
Open the fuel tank cap (4) completely. Variant 2: After the deactivation time Keep the active key (2) or the passive key (3) within the recognizing area;
Slowly pull the lid of the fuel tank cap (4) upwards;
Wait for the key to be recognized;
Slowly pull the lid of the fuel tank cap (4) upwards again;
Fuel tank cap (4) unlocked;
Open the fuel tank cap (4) completely. 1.6 Anti-theft alarm system 1.6.1 Anti-theft alarm system arming To arm the anti-theft alarm system:
Press the Lock/Unlock button (6) to switch off the ignition;
Press button B1 of the active key (2) twice. 1.6.2 Anti-theft alarm system disarming The anti-theft system can be interrupted at any time by pressing the button B2 of the active key

Certification 5.1 USA Certification Product name: Keyless Ride System Main Unit FCC ID: VFZKLRMZB001 Product name: Keyless Ride System Active key FCC ID: VFZKLRKZB002 Warnings This device complies with part 15 of the FCC Rules. Operation is subject to the following two conditions: (1) This device may not cause harmful interference, and (2) this device must accept any interference received, including interference that may cause undesired operation. FCC 15.105 Information to the user statements This equipment has been tested and found to comply with the limits for a Class B digital device, pursuant to part 15 of the FCC Rules. These limits are designed to provide reasonable protection against harmful interference in a residential installation. This equipment generates, uses and can radiate radio frequency energy and, if not installed and used in accordance with the instructions, may cause harmful interference to radio communications. However, there is no guarantee that interference will not occur in a particular installation. If this equipment does cause harmful interference to radio or television reception, which can be determined by turning the equipment off and on, the user is encouraged to try to correct the interference by one or more of the following measures:
Reorient or relocate the receiving antenna. Increase the separation between the equipment and receiver. Connect the equipment into an outlet on a circuit different from that to which the receiver is connected. Consult the dealer or an experienced radio/TV technician for help. FCC 15.21 - Information to user. Changes or modifications not expressly approved by the party responsible for compliance could void the user's authority to operate the equipment.
